gpsnerd wrote:
how to know if a gps has this store route function??

Actually the related features are the ability to save routes and the capability to perform multiple point routing. You can check at Nuvi's spec for these features. Supported automotive Nuvis include Nuvi5xx, Nuvi7xx, Nuvi8xx, Nuvi14xx and Nuvi16xx.

gpsnerd wrote:
too bad a nuvi itself cannot allow us to set our preferred route and then the gps just guide us along

If your Nuvi is none of the above, you can still somewhat tweak the route by introducing a via point between the start and finish points, however it's only limited to a single via point.
